As we prepare our hearts for Easter during this Jubilee Year of Hope, Catholics across the archdiocese are invited to experience God’s mercy in a powerful way on Reconciliation Monday, April 14.

To help us enter more deeply into this sacrament, we turn to Father Gabriel Gillen, O.P., who offers this short reflection on how to make a good Confession. Whether it’s been months or many years—Jesus is waiting to meet you with His Mercy.

Listen now to Father Gabriel as he reflects on how we can have a grace-filled Confession.

Before going to Confession, make a good Examination of Conscience.
